I agree with you. My mom is very into plants but she never calls her pots of mini trees penjing. But I guess there's the language aspect of the word usage as well: 'penjing' (literally pot of scenery) sounds very formal like written language, not very colloquial. It would sound like an advertising word as if from a production video or a market. Whereas the Japanese counterpart is regarded as an established high art/profession (which is common in Japanese society).
